How to Support a Partner Facing Infertility
Infertility can be a challenging and emotional journey for couples. When your partner is facing infertility, it's important to provide them with the support and understanding they need during this difficult time. Here are some ways you can support your partner through their infertility struggles:
Learn About Infertility
Educate yourself about infertility to better understand what your partner is going through. Infertility affects approximately 10-15% of couples worldwide, so it's more common than you may think. Knowing the facts about infertility can help you empathize with your partner's feelings and experiences.
Communicate Openly
Encourage open and honest communication with your partner about their feelings and concerns regarding infertility. Create a safe space for them to express their emotions without judgment. Let them know that you are there to listen and support them through this journey.
Attend Appointments Together
Accompany your partner to medical appointments and fertility treatments whenever possible. Your presence can provide comfort and reassurance during what can be a stressful and overwhelming process. Show your support by being actively involved in their healthcare journey.
Offer Emotional Support
Infertility can take a toll on your partner's mental and emotional well-being. Be a source of emotional support by offering words of encouragement, reassurance, and love. Let your partner know that you are in this together and that you will face any challenges as a team.
Take Care of Yourself
Remember to take care of yourself while supporting your partner through infertility. It's essential to prioritize your own well-being and mental health during this challenging time. Seek support from friends, family, or a therapist if you need help processing your emotions.
Explore Alternative Paths to Parenthood
Consider exploring alternative paths to parenthood with your partner, such as adoption or surrogacy. Discussing these options together can help you both feel more hopeful about the future and the possibility of starting a family in a different way.
Supporting a partner facing infertility requires patience, understanding, and compassion. By being there for your partner every step of the way, you can strengthen your relationship and navigate the challenges of infertility together.
